# Train_Prep — Claude Code Plugin
A Claude Code plugin that encapsulates a complete **AI consulting training material preparation workflow** — from industry pain point research to delivering a Word report and interactive HTML presentation, all orchestrated with multi-agent parallelism.
## What It Does
Given a client and industry context (+ optional reference PDFs), the `Train_Prep` skill will:
1. **Research** (parallel agents) — Analyze industry pain points across 3 business phases, map them to AI solutions
2. **Word Report** — Assemble a structured `.docx` solution proposal via pandoc
3. **HTML Slides** — Generate an interactive, full-screen HTML presentation with keyboard/touch navigation
## Demo Output
The skill was originally created to prepare training materials for Pearl River Delta intercity rail executives. It produced:
- A 40-pain-point solution proposal Word report
- A 34-slide interactive HTML training presentation

## Workflow Architecture
```
┌─────────────────────────────────────────────────────┐
│ Train_Prep Workflow │
├─────────────────────────────────────────────────────┤
│ Phase 1: Research (3 parallel agents) │
│ Agent A ──► Phase 1 pain points + solutions │
│ Agent B ──► Phase 2 pain points + solutions │
│ Agent C ──► Phase 3 pain points + impl. plan │
├─────────────────────────────────────────────────────┤
│ Phase 2: Word Report │
│ Assemble Markdown ──► pandoc ──► .docx │
├─────────────────────────────────────────────────────┤
│ Phase 3: HTML Slides (4 parallel agents) │
│ Agent A ──► HTML framework + CSS + JS + cover │
│ Agent B ──► Phase 1 slides │
│ Agent C ──► Phase 2 slides │
│ Agent D ──► Phase 3 + impl. plan + closing │
│ Main ────► macOS-compatible assembly script │
└─────────────────────────────────────────────────────┘
```

## Key Technical Notes
- **PDF extraction**: Uses `pdftotext` (more reliable than Claude's built-in PDF reader for text extraction)
- **macOS compatibility**: `head -n -N` (negative line count) is not supported on macOS — the skill uses `lines=$(wc -l < file); head -n $((lines-N)) file` instead
- **HTML assembly**: Multi-agent HTML parts use a strict interface contract (Part 1 leaves `slide-container` unclosed; Part 4 closes it with `</body></html>`)
- **Dynamic slide counting**: Uses `MutationObserver` instead of hardcoded totals, enabling agents to work independently without coordination
